I am a member of the Solent LN and a Trustee of IET Connect. Many of you know that IET Connect supports IET members and their families but you may not know that their support is ever-evolving, and they are constantly looking for new ways to make a difference. 
 
This is why IET Connect has commissioned independent research into the current and future needs of the engineering community. The research will be taking place over the coming months and the results will inform the ways IET Connect supports you now and in the future.  

As a member of the IET, you and your immediate family are eligible for free lifetime support from IET Connect. Some of the support they offer includes:
  • Funding counselling for anxiety or anxiety-related depression as part of a new partnership with Anxiety UK

  • Long or short-term financial support - day-to-day costs or larger unexpected expenses

  • Support for carers - respite, home care and local support services

  • One-to-one career coaching - eg if out of work

  • Disability or health condition - help to access specialist advice, check entitled benefits, fund home adaptations & care

  • Autism support – funding National Autistic Society membership and any home adaptations or care

  • Legal advice - including on employment, consumer, family, property, wills, probate and tax

  • Debt advice

  • Retirement workshops – advice on finances and other matters (when approaching or after retirement)
